java.net.ConnectException: Connection timed out: connect--解决方案
java.net.ConnectException: Connection timed out: connect--解决方案解决方案:1.windows防火墙-->允许程序或功能通过windows防火墙-->勾上不能访问程序(java(TM) Plaform SE binary:如果找不到使用第二种解决方案)-->确定--->完成 2.windows
![](https://csdnimg.cn/release/devpress/public/img/ic-book.4f347164.png)
一键AI生成摘要,助你高效阅读
问答
·
解决方案:
1.windows防火墙-->允许程序或功能通过windows防火墙-->勾上不能访问程序(java(TM) Plaform SE binary:如果找不到使用第二种解决方案)-->确定
--->完成
2.windows防火墙->
关闭防火墙---->重新启动你先前使用不起的程序,这时可以了(为了安全, 最好将防火墙开启)--->开启防火墙
-->防火墙将询问你是否*程序访问网络(如果有多个网络,这时你得选择你正在使用的网络)--->完成
3.高级设置:
![点击查看原始大小图片](http://dl.iteye.com/upload/attachment/0076/5489/4dd5fbfe-4263-3e23-a2af-d74270b3f367.jpg)
![点击查看原始大小图片](http://dl.iteye.com/upload/attachment/0076/5491/ecceea14-4f72-37a4-9011-7af9ee549df0.jpg)
例如:mysql的远程访问,ip就是ping得通,它就是不能访问,纠其原因,端口被killer了,开放myslq端口即可访问
发生的原因:
防火墙阻止程序访问网络
网络更换后, 防火墙 将启用新的防火墙规则--什么都没有,
这样,更换后所有再访问网络的程序--防火墙都将视为新程序--这时, 要你定义的新的防火墙规则
--询问你:是否允许*程序访问正在使用的网络-->是否由你决定
异常信息:
- java.io.IOException: Unable to establish loopback connection
- at sun.nio.ch.PipeImpl$Initializer.run(PipeImpl.java:106)
- at java.security.AccessController.doPrivileged(Native Method)
- at sun.nio.ch.PipeImpl.<init>(PipeImpl.java:122)
- at sun.nio.ch.SelectorProviderImpl.openPipe(SelectorProviderImpl.java:27)
- at java.nio.channels.Pipe.open(Pipe.java:133)
- at sun.nio.ch.WindowsSelectorImpl.<init>(WindowsSelectorImpl.java:104)
- at sun.nio.ch.WindowsSelectorProvider.openSelector(WindowsSelectorProvider.java:26)
- at java.nio.channels.Selector.open(Selector.java:209)
- at org.eclipse.jetty.io.nio.SelectorManager$SelectSet.<init>(SelectorManager.java:353)
- at org.eclipse.jetty.io.nio.SelectorManager.doStart(SelectorManager.java:234)
- at org.eclipse.jetty.util.component.AbstractLifeCycle.start(AbstractLifeCycle.java:55)
- at org.eclipse.jetty.server.nio.SelectChannelConnector.doStart(SelectChannelConnector.java:273)
- at org.eclipse.jetty.util.component.AbstractLifeCycle.start(AbstractLifeCycle.java:55)
- at org.eclipse.jetty.server.Server.doStart(Server.java:254)
- at org.eclipse.jetty.util.component.AbstractLifeCycle.start(AbstractLifeCycle.java:55)
- Caused by: java.net.ConnectException: Connection timed out: connect
- at sun.nio.ch.Net.connect(Native Method)
- at sun.nio.ch.SocketChannelImpl.connect(SocketChannelImpl.java:500)
- at java.nio.channels.SocketChannel.open(SocketChannel.java:146)
- at sun.nio.ch.PipeImpl$Initializer.run(PipeImpl.java:78)
- ... 18 more
更多推荐
所有评论(0)